What does my Friday the 13th mean?

Friday the 13th is a date that is considered unlucky in many cultures. This belief dates back to the Middle Ages, when many believed that the number 13 was an unlucky number. Also, Friday the 13th is considered a day of the witches, so there are many superstitions associated with this date. For example, some people avoid planning important activities on this day, while others avoid leaving the house.

There are many theories about the origin of the belief that Friday the 13th is an unlucky day. Some believe it dates back to the year 1307, when King Philip IV of France sent his soldiers to arrest the Knights Templar. Others believe that it dates back to the bible, when the thirteenth guest at the dinner of the Twelve Apostles was Judas Iscariot, who betrayed Jesus. Whatever the origin, Friday the 13th is still a day feared by many people.
